Metal Back Strip brushes consist of densely compressed synthetic, natural bristles or wire filaments laid down over a continuous metal channel while being formed into a "U" shape. A binding wire is inserted over the filament materials and forced down into the partially formed metal backing. The binding wire causes the fill material to form vertically as the metal backing forms and closes over the binding wire and filament. Metal back strip brushes are the most economical bursh manufactured due to the simple form of construction. Strip brushes are manufactured for many brush seal and cleaning applications
Weatherstrip brushes properly seal gaps of overhead doors, dock levelers, entrance doors and windows. Brush seals are the most effective in preventing air infiltration and helping bring down heating and cooling costs. Air filtration means interior air is being displaced by exterior air entering through gaps left unsealed. Weatherstrip Brush Seals reduce the pentration of uninvited enviromental elements, including dust, light, blowing dirt, sand, rain, snow, fumes, insects and rodents.
Tanis Weatherstrip Brush Seals are more effective than any other weatherstrip product. They are designed to last longer and seal better than vinyl, felt and neoprene. The nylon fill material provides a long-life cycle and durability even in the coldest temperatures. Nylon will stay flexible at 70 degrees below F where vinyl and other
materials can freeze and become brittle. In ddition, nylon also has a melting point above 400 deg.F. The nylon filament flexability conforms to the different contours to tightly seal any opening.

Easy to mount and to install aluminum holders are provided in several profile shapes shown at this web site. They are available in different lenghts and extruded in different profile shapes upon request. Aluminum holders can be provided with or without mounting holes or slots for faster installation. They are most commonly extruded with a mill finish, but can be painted or anodized in either a clear, gold, red, black, blue or dark brown finish. Other colors availabe upon request.
